[Read more]( [***] [Electricity Generating Companies GenCos ]( GenCos release 3,919MW of electricity on June 3 — Report Electricity Generating Companies (GenCos) comprising gas-fired and hydro stations released an average of 3, 919 MegaWatts (MW) of power into the national grid on Monday, a daily energy report has said. The report, which was compiled by the Advisory Power Team, Office of the Vice President, was made available on Tuesday in Abuja. It said that the energy released by the companies was up by 139.64MW from the figure delivered on Sunday. [Read more]( [***] [ITEC] [***] [Trump s trade war]( Trump's trade wars sent global investment tumbling – World Bank Donald Trump’s trade wars with China, Mexico and Europe have sent global investment tumbling, according to a World Bank report that forecasts worldwide growth this year will slip back to levels not seen since 2016. The Washington-based lender to developing world countries said in its half-yearly global health check that spiralling political uncertainty was to blame for a slowdown in trade and a collapse in investment spending that will push down GDP growth to 2.6% this year “before inching up to 2.7% in 2020”. [Read more]( [***] [Firefox]( Firefox joins Apple to block third-party cookies online Mozilla Corp.’s Firefox browser joined Apple Inc.’s Safari in blocking certain kinds of online tracking or third-party cookies, leaving Google’s Chrome as the only major browser that doesn’t bar these tools by default. Going forward, new downloads of Firefox will automatically block trackers known as third-party cookies, which can follow users around the web and log their activity. Safari blocked them in 2017. Flesch reading score

Flesch reading score measures how complex a text is. The lower the score, the more difficult the text is to read. The Flesch readability score uses the average length of your sentences (measured by the number of words) and the average number of syllables per word in an equation to calculate the reading ease. Text with a very high Flesch reading ease score (about 100) is straightforward and easy to read, with short sentences and no words of more than two syllables. Usually, a reading ease score of 60-70 is considered acceptable/normal for web copy.
